A doctor draws blood from your arm and spins it through a centrifuge to separate the platelet-rich plasma (PRP), which is then injected back into your face, giving you the creepy vampire facelift made famous by Kim Kardashian’s blood-soaked self-portrait? Collagen is stimulated during this procedure, which is supposed to leave you feeling rejuvenated, radiant, and *FlAwLeSs*. You can now use the same method for your cleavage.

PRP has recently been used to create fuller and perkier cleavage by cosmetic dermatologist Charles Runels, the inventor of the vampire facelift. Runels tells landscapeinsight. that he has been able to lift saggy boobs, increase cleavage, fix inverted nipples, erase stretch marks, and increase breast and nipple sensitivity by drawing, spinning, and reinserting blood back into the breasts.

While the $1,800 treatment isn’t a substitute for implants and won’t instantly double your cup size (Runels claims you’ll look like you’re wearing a pushup bra even when you’re braless), it will reshape and round out your bust. As a bonus, it makes nipples appear redder and more vibrant. The VBL has also been shown to be effective in improving rippled breast implants, correcting inverted nipples, and erasing stretch marks.

Vampire facelifts use PRP injections, which can be quite expensive at $1,125 each.

Depending on how many injections are needed, the total cost may be slightly higher than for a VBL.

A VBL can cost between $1,500 and $2,000, depending on the model.

As a cosmetic procedure, VBL is not covered by insurance. Payment plans and promotional financing are two options that your provider may provide to help with the costs.

Getting your blood drawn and getting an injection can cause some discomfort. Generally speaking, the procedure doesn’t cause a lot of pain.

Since the VBL is noninvasive, its creators claim that it is safer than a traditional lift or implant. ‘ Infection, scarring, and other side effects are possible outcomes of any surgery.

It’s unclear how the injections will affect mammograms or breast cancer risk in the long term because this is a new and experimental procedure.

As a non-invasive procedure, there is no downtime associated with a VBL. However, the bruising and swelling will disappear within a few days.

After their appointment, the majority of people are able to resume their normal routines right away.

The injections will cause “injuries” to your skin, and your skin will respond by forming new tissues. Over the next few months, you can expect to see a shift in the color and texture of your breasts.

It will take about three months for you to see full results. Official VBL results should last up to two years, the website says.
